Thy kingdom come on earth as it is in heaven

2 Corinthians 5. 17-19

So if anyone is in Christ, there is a new creation: everything old has passed away; see, everything has become new! All this is from God, who reconciled us to himself through Christ, and has given us the ministry of reconciliation; that is, in Christ God was reconciling the world to himself.

There are times when we all know that we need healing and that our world needs healing. There are times when we are painfully aware of how far we feel from being the kind of people we would like to be, how far from home we are. The promise of the Bible is that God can make of us a new creation, making us whole in ourselves and reconciling us to one another. Indeed this is a mark of the way his kingdom is - a place where people can start afresh and be remade.



  • What do you think needs to be made new in your life?
  • Are there people you need to be reconciled with?
This video of R.E.M's song is a reminder of the sense of alienation many people feel sometimes, and some feel often. The truth is that, though we can feel as if we are the only one feeling like this, actually "everybody hurts". When we can accept that we are halfway to making a community where those hurts can be acknowledge and perhaps healed.
